The GigaRise slot mechanic is an expanding-reel system created by Yggdrasil in which special symbols increase the height of individual reels. The important difference from a simple expanding-reel feature is persistence: once a reel grows, its increased height can remain between spins until that reel reaches its maximum level and triggers the reward event defined by the game. After the event, the reel can reset and begin building again. Yggdrasil describes GigaRise as part of its Game Engagement Mechanics portfolio.

GigaRise in brief

  • Special GigaRise symbols increase the height of individual reels.
  • Reel progress can persist from one spin to the next.
  • Taller reels may create additional symbol positions, paylines or ways to win, depending on the slot.
  • Reaching maximum reel height can trigger Free Spins, a Bonus Game or another feature.
  • The exact maximum height, win system and bonus rules depend on the individual GigaRise slot.

GigaRise is therefore most relevant to players who enjoy visible progression rather than a completely reset reel configuration after every spin. However, expanding a reel does not guarantee a win. The underlying outcome remains determined by the game’s random system and mathematical model.

What Is the GigaRise Slot Mechanic?

GigaRise is a persistent reel-expansion mechanic. Instead of keeping every reel at the same fixed height, a GigaRise slot can allow specific reels to grow vertically when designated symbols appear.

The mechanic was introduced by Yggdrasil with Atlantean GigaRise, which uses rising reels to increase the available ways to win and connect the reel progression with bonus features. Yggdrasil identifies Atlantean GigaRise as the first game to use the mechanic.

The key concept is not simply “bigger reels.” It is the progression toward a maximum reel height.

  1. A slot begins with reels at their normal height.
  2. A designated GigaRise symbol lands.
  3. The corresponding reel increases in height.
  4. The new reel height remains available for subsequent spins.
  5. Additional qualifying symbols can increase it again.
  6. The reel eventually reaches its maximum height.
  7. A bonus event or other feature linked to that reel is activated.
  8. The reel resets according to the game’s rules.

Individual GigaRise games can modify this structure substantially, so the paytable and game rules remain the definitive source for a particular title.

How Does GigaRise Work in Slots?

The easiest way to understand how GigaRise works in slots is to think of every expandable reel as a progress meter.

Instead of filling a traditional meter beside the reels, the reel itself becomes taller.

Suppose a game begins with a reel three symbols high. A special GigaRise symbol lands on Reel 2 and raises it to four symbols. Later, another qualifying symbol appears on Reel 2 and raises it again. The expanded height can remain between spins, allowing the player to see how close that reel is to its maximum.

Yggdrasil’s general description of GigaRise states that reel height persists between spins and that reaching maximum height produces an award event. The exact event can differ between games.

This persistence is what makes the mechanic feel different from reel modifiers that appear for only one spin.

What Happens When a GigaRise Reel Gets Taller?

A taller GigaRise reel creates additional symbol positions. What those additional positions actually mean depends on the game’s win system.

A slot based on ways to win may gain additional winning ways as the reels expand. A slot using paylines may instead activate additional paylines or give the player more positions on which qualifying combinations can form.

For example, Atlantean GigaRise can expand toward as many as 32,768 ways to win. Dragon Lore GigaRise uses a different structure, with five reels capable of growing to nine rows and up to 100 active paylines.

This distinction is important because there is no universal number of rows, paylines or winning ways attached to the GigaRise name.

More reel positions do not guarantee a win

Expanding reels can change the configuration of the game, but they should not be interpreted as a progression system that eventually owes the player a payout.

Even if the screen becomes substantially larger, the slot’s mathematical model still determines symbol outcomes, payouts, RTP and feature behavior.

The practical benefit of GigaRise is therefore better described as unlocking additional game states and feature opportunities, not creating a guaranteed winning sequence.

Why Does Reel Persistence Matter?

Persistence gives GigaRise a different rhythm from ordinary expanding reels.

When a normal temporary expansion disappears immediately after a spin, the next spin effectively begins from the original configuration. With GigaRise, previously accumulated reel height can remain visible.

That creates a longer progression cycle.

For example, one reel might already be close to maximum height while another remains near its starting level. A later GigaRise symbol landing on the taller reel may therefore have a different practical consequence than the same symbol landing on a shorter reel.

This does not mean the player can predict when the relevant symbol will appear. It simply means that previously unlocked reel states can influence what a future qualifying symbol activates.

What Happens at Maximum GigaRise Height?

Reaching maximum reel height normally connects the expanding reel with a feature or award event, but the reward is game-specific.

Yggdrasil’s description of the mechanic says that a reel reaching maximum height can produce an award event such as Free Spins or another round of a Bonus Game, after which the reel height resets.

This makes maximum height the central objective built into the mechanic.

A developer can then design different rewards around it, including:

  • bonus rounds;
  • free spins;
  • respins;
  • special wild behavior;
  • jackpots;
  • multipliers;
  • game-specific prize features.

Players should check the actual paytable rather than assuming that every GigaRise slot awards the same feature.

Atlantean GigaRise as an Example

Atlantean GigaRise shows the original concept particularly clearly.

The game uses expanding reels that increase the number of available ways to win as they rise. Yggdrasil lists a maximum of 32,768 ways to win, along with Free Spins, a Bonus Game and jackpot functionality. The provider lists the game’s theoretical RTP as 96%, although RTP should always be checked in the version offered by a specific casino.

Atlantean GigaRise demonstrates three basic elements of the mechanic:

  • reel growth is progressive;
  • increasing reel size affects the game’s winning structure;
  • maximum reel development connects with additional features.

It should not be assumed that every later GigaRise title copies Atlantean’s exact configuration.

Dragon Lore GigaRise Shows How the Mechanic Can Change

Dragon Lore GigaRise demonstrates why GigaRise should be understood as a framework rather than one rigid reel layout.

Yggdrasil describes Dragon Lore GigaRise as a five-reel game in which the reels can grow as high as nine rows, with as many as 100 active paylines. The title also combines the expanding structure with respins, Free Spins, mystery stacked symbols and Super Wild behavior.

That is significantly different from the ways-to-win structure used by Atlantean GigaRise.

The useful takeaway is that seeing “GigaRise” in a slot title tells you how progression is broadly handled, but not the complete math model or bonus structure.

GigaRise vs Megaways

GigaRise and Megaways can both create unusually large reel configurations, but the mechanics should not be treated as synonyms.

GigaRise focuses on persistent reel growth. Special symbols progressively increase individual reel heights, and those heights can remain between spins until a maximum level produces an event.

Megaways is primarily a dynamic reel-modifier system. The number of symbols appearing on the reels can change, producing a changing number of ways to win. Many Megaways games offer up to 117,649 ways to win, although individual implementations can differ.

The main practical difference is therefore progression.

GigaRise makes the growth of the reels itself part of an accumulating feature. Megaways commonly emphasizes changing reel configurations and changing numbers of winning ways.

Some modern slots can also combine expanding-reel concepts with other mechanics, so the name of the mechanic alone should never replace reading the actual rules.

Does GigaRise Increase RTP?

GigaRise does not automatically mean a higher RTP.

RTP is determined by the complete mathematical model of a slot, including symbol probabilities, payout values, bonus frequency, feature values and other components. GigaRise is one part of that design.

Two games using GigaRise can therefore have different RTP settings.

More rows or additional winning ways also do not mean that the casino suddenly loses its mathematical advantage. The payout model is designed around the complete reel configuration.

Always check the RTP displayed in the actual game information because casinos and jurisdictions may offer different approved configurations.

Does GigaRise Mean High Volatility?

GigaRise does not define a slot’s volatility by itself.

Volatility describes how payouts are distributed, including the balance between frequency and potential size of wins. GigaRise describes how the reel system develops.

Dragon Lore GigaRise, for example, is identified by Yggdrasil as a high-volatility title, but that characteristic belongs to the individual game’s mathematical model rather than establishing a rule for every GigaRise release.

Players who care about bankroll fluctuations should therefore check volatility separately instead of assuming it from the mechanic.

GigaRise vs Standard Expanding Reels

The main difference between GigaRise and basic expanding reels is persistent progression.

A standard expanding-reel feature may simply make the screen larger temporarily. The reel could expand during one winning combination, one respin or one bonus round and then immediately return to normal.

GigaRise turns reel height into a state that can develop across spins.

This distinction matters because players can visually track progress toward the feature linked with maximum height. It gives the mechanic a collection-like feel even though the qualifying symbols themselves remain random.

Common GigaRise Myths

“A nearly full reel means a bonus is about to happen”

Not necessarily. A reel may be close to its maximum height, but the qualifying symbol still has to occur according to the game’s rules.

Visible progress should not be interpreted as a prediction of the next spin.

“More rows mean every spin has better RTP”

No. RTP is a long-term theoretical percentage determined by the complete game model.

The current reel configuration may affect the available combinations or features, but it does not turn RTP into a session-level prediction.

“You should keep playing because the reels have already grown”

This is a particularly risky interpretation of persistent mechanics.

Money already spent does not guarantee that continuing will recover previous losses or complete a feature within a particular number of spins. A player should remain willing to stop even when visible progression is present.

What to Check Before Playing a GigaRise Slot

Before playing any GigaRise title, open the game’s information or paytable and check the rules for that specific version.

Focus on:

  • starting reel dimensions;
  • maximum reel height;
  • what symbol increases reel height;
  • whether every reel grows independently;
  • when expanded reels reset;
  • what happens at maximum height;
  • paylines or ways to win;
  • RTP;
  • volatility;
  • maximum win;
  • Free Spins rules;
  • respin rules;
  • jackpot rules, if applicable;
  • available bet range.

These details tell you considerably more about the actual experience than the GigaRise label alone.

RTP and volatility are especially important to understand correctly. RTP is a theoretical long-term value and does not predict what will happen during one session. Volatility describes payout distribution rather than the probability of finishing a particular feature.
